While checking the value of your annals on sites such as ebay and other record vendor is a great idea, it is one and only half the engagement. First you need to know what condition your archives are in. If you try to put up for sale poor records for the mint price you saw on ebay and gemm you will enjoy quite a few angry buyers. So first construct sure you know exactly what you have, next grade your files. Once armed with that info, you can check other peoples pricing. Unless you own a really valuable diary, try to price competitively. To get you started, here is a journal grading chart. Good luck!
Mint (M) Absolutely superlative in every process. Certainly never been played, possibly even still hermetic.(More on still sealed lower than "Other Considerations"). Should be used sparingly as a grade, If at adjectives.
Near Mint (NM or M-) A nearly perfect story. Many dealers won't offer a grade greater than this implying (perhaps correctly)that no diary is ever truly perfect.
The journal should show no obvious signs of wear. A 45 RPM or EP sleeve should own no more than the most minor defects, such as almost invisible ring wear or other signs of slight handling.
An LP cover should enjoy no creases, folds, seam splits or other noticeable similar defect. No cut-out holes, either. And unsurprisingly, the same should be true of any other inserts, such as posters, lyric sleeves and the approaching.
Basically, an LP in close mint condition looks as if you just get it home from a new account store and removed the shrink wrap.
Near Mint is the highest price timetabled in adjectives Goldmine price guides. Anything that exceeds this grade, within the opinion of both buyer and trader, is worth significantly more than the highest Goldmine book convenience.
Very Good Plus (VG+) Generally worth 50 percent of the Near Mint value.
A Very Good Plus history will show some signs that it was played and otherwise handle by a previous owner who took good supervision of it.
Record surfaces may show some signs of wear and may have slight scuff or very street light scratches that don't affect one's listen experiences. Slight warps that do not affect the nouns are "OK".
The label may own some ring wear or discoloration, but it should be barely apparent. The center hole will not have be misshapen by repeated play.
Picture sleeves and LP inner sleeves will have some slight wear, insubstantially turned up corners, or a slight seam split. An LP cover may have slight signs of wear also and may be marred by a cut-out hole, indentation or corner indicating it be taken out of print and sold at a discount.
In general, except for a couple things wrong with it, this would be Near Mint. All but the most mint-crazy collectors will find a Very Good Plus narrative highly agreeable.
Very Good (VG) Generally worth 25 percent of Near Mint value. Many of the defect found in a VG+ text will be more pronounced in a VG disc. Surface uproar will be evident upon playing, especially within soft passages and during a song's intro and fade, but will not overpower the music otherwise. Groove wear will start to be striking, as with street light scratches (deep satisfactory to feel beside a fingernail) that will affect the sound.
Labels may be marred by writing, or hold tape or stickers (or their residue) attached. The same will be true of picture sleeves or LP covers. However, it will not own all of these problems at alike time, only two or three of them.
Goldmine price guides next to more than one price will list Very Good as the lowest price. This, not the Near Mint price, should be your guide when determining how much a history is worth, as that is the price a pusher will normally foot you for a Near Mint record.
Good (G), Good Plus (G+) Generally worth 10-15 percent of the Near Mint helpfulness. Good does not mean Bad! A narrative in Good or Good Plus condition can be put onto a turntable and will play through in need skipping. But it will have significant surface swish and scratches and detectable groove wear (on a styrene record, the groove will be starting to turn white).
A cover or sleeve will own seam splits, especially at the bottom or on the spine. Tape, writing, ring wear or other defects will start to overwhelm the baulk.
It is a common item, you'll probably find another copy surrounded by better shape eventually. Pass it up. But, if it's something you have be seeking for years, and the price is right, get it...but hold on to looking to upgrade.
Poor (P), Fair (F) Generally worth 0-5 percent of the Near Mint price. The record is cracked, inadequately warped, and won't play through short skipping or repeating. The picture sleeve is water tatty, split on all three seam and heavily marred by wear and writing. The LP cover barely keep the LP inside it. Inner sleeves are fully seam split, crinkled, and written upon.
Except for impossibly rare accounts otherwise unattainable, records within this condition should be bought or sold for no more than a few cents each.
